Can you use Frontline spot on on kittens?
Can you use Frontline spot on on kittens?
FRONTLINE Spot On for Cats is for use in the treatment of fleas and the prevention of infestations by fleas and ticks or as part of a treatment strategy for Flea Allergy Dermatitis. FRONTLINE Spot On for Cats 6 pack can be used on kittens from 8 weeks of age.

Can you use flea spot on kittens?
It can be applied to cats from 8 weeks of age that weigh at least 1 kg. It can also be used on pregnant and nursing cats. FRONTLINE® Spot On is a topical treatment which goes over your cat’s skin and hair to kill fleas and ticks through contact with them – they don’t have to bite your cat to be killed.

Is Frontline harmful to cats if they lick it?
Frontline (Merial): “If licking occurs, a brief period of hypersalivation may be observed due mainly to the nature of the carrier.” Advantage and Advantage Multi (Bayer): “Oral ingestion by cats may result in hypersalivation, tremors, vomiting, and decreased appetite.”

What is the difference between FRONTLINE Plus and Frontline spot on?
Frontline Plus boasts all of the benefits of the original Frontline Spot On product but it comes with a dual action formula that not only kills fleas and ticks on your pet but it also prevents the eggs from hatching in and around your home.

How quickly does spot on flea treatment work?
Advantage contains an active ingredient that spreads quickly from the point of application, killing fleas within one day and preventing further infestations for up to four weeks in dogs, three to four weeks in cats and one week in rabbits.
